Output 3e3ba18516dcbaf14c44c8c031307b4195d4f22a456bcbd5b536c11c47c743ac:3

value
89503079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ce659ed278daa8fe9750f39b37e8e2e73b65f OP_EQUAL
address
MRD4a5F9fz8zFu9vA1fUCtTCEc8ryuns5z
transaction
3e3ba18516dcbaf14c44c8c031307b4195d4f22a456bcbd5b536c11c47c743ac
spent
true